Carla Harris At A Glance:

As the first African American to join Morgan Stanley’s management committee, Carla Harris shares proven strategies that have helped her succeed and thrive on Wall Street. She helps audiences maximize success.

Carla Harris is a Vice Chairman, Wealth Management, Managing Director and Senior Client Advisor at Morgan Stanley. The breadth of her industry experience enables her to move effortlessly from topics of technology, retail, or media sectors to healthcare, telecommunications, and transportation. Ms. Harris began her career with Morgan Stanley in the Mergers & Acquisitions department in 1987. Prior to joining Morgan Stanley, Carla received from Harvard Business School an MBA, Second Year Honors and an AB in economics from Harvard University, Magna Cum Laude. President Barack Obama appointed Carla to chair the National Women’s Business Council in 2013.

With audiences, Carla is applauded for her grace and humor, as well as what she calls “Carla’s Pearls,” delightful bits of evergreen wisdom. Her presentations are colored with her experience as a senior member of the equity syndicate desk, executing transactions such as initial public offerings for UPS, Martha Stewart Living Omnimedia, Ariba, Redback, and the $3.2 Billion common stock transaction for Immunex Corporation. She has been named to Fortune Magazine’s 50 Most Powerful Black Executives in Corporate America, U. S. Bankers Top 25 Most Powerful Women in Finance, and Black Enterprise’s Top 75 Most Powerful Women in Business, to mention a few.

Carla’s belief is that “we are blessed so that we can be a blessing to someone else.” As a result, she remains actively involved in her community and carries the energy of that empowering spirit to each presentation.

  • Carla's Pearls: Tools for Maximizing Your Success.

    Carla speaks about the proven strategies that have helped her succeed and thrive on Wall Street. This presentation shines the light on her self-described "Pearls" of wisdom. She helps audiences maximize success from where they currently find themselves, as well as increasing the odds of reaching the position they aspire to. Discussion points include the importance—and the power—of perceptions in the workplace, key relationships needed to ensure your success, and the role authenticity plays in being a powerful leader.
  • Leadership: Currency, Change, & Creating A Powerful Presence.

    Carla Harris is the Vice Chairman of Morgan Stanley, that’s true. But she is also a gospel recording artist, and author of two books: Expect to Win: 10 Proven Strategies to Surviving in the Workplace and Strategize to Win: The New Way to Start Out, Step Up, or Start Over in Your Career. In this presentation, Carla talks with audiences about the components of positioning yourself to maximize success as a leader in your current career environment or in the environment you desire. The concepts of performance currency vs. relationship currency are explored, as well as how to manage change, create change, and become an impactful and influential leader.
